What is the PayPal Sandbox?
The PayPal sandbox is a testing environment that allows developers to test and develop their applications without affecting the production environment. It is a replica of the production environment, with the same features and functionality, but with fake data and test transactions. The sandbox is used to test and debug applications before they are deployed to the production environment.
What is the PayPal Sandbox App ID?
The PayPal sandbox app ID is a unique identifier assigned to your application when you create a PayPal developer account. It is used to identify your application in the PayPal sandbox environment. The app ID is used to authenticate and authorize your application to access the PayPal API.
